The Governance & Strategy Manager will support the Head of the Technology Management Office (TMO) in driving execution of CIO priorities by ensuring robust governance, strategic tracking, and cross-functional coordination across Technology units. This role will be responsible for managing and tracking action items emerging from key governance forums such as the MBO, SteerCo, and Governance Day, ensuring timely closure and visibility to leadership.
A key focus will be on designing and maintaining the CIO dashboard, consolidating inputs from all Technology units, and tracking KPIs to provide a comprehensive view of performance, strategic alignment, and delivery progress. The incumbent will work closely with the Transformation Office to maintain an up-to-date view of all Technology projects, ensuring alignment with strategic goals and timely reporting of progress, risks, and dependencies.
Additionally, the role will liaise with HR to ensure organizational structures across Technology are current, accurately reflect reporting lines, and support strategic workforce planning. The incumbent will also support the Head of TMO in preparing executive-level reports, presentations, and insights for senior leadership and governance bodies.
